1. What Is Ground Clearance and Why Does It Matter?

Ground clearance is the distance between the lowest point of a vehicle and the ground. For the Audi A6 Avant, this measurement is crucial as it determines how well the car can navigate over obstacles without scraping the undercarriage. In simple terms, higher clearance means less chance of getting stuck or damaged on uneven terrain. 🤔✨

3. Off-Road Performance: Can the Audi A6 Avant Handle Tough Terrain?

While the Audi A6 Avant isn’t built for hardcore off-roading, its ground clearance and all-wheel-drive system make it surprisingly versatile. The Quattro all-wheel-drive system ensures that power is distributed evenly among the wheels, providing better traction and stability on slippery or uneven surfaces. 🌬️🍃


Whether you’re driving through a light snowstorm or navigating a gravel driveway, the A6 Avant can handle it with ease. However, attempting to take it on rugged trails or deep mud would be pushing its limits. Remember, it’s still a luxury sedan at heart, designed for comfort and performance on paved roads. 🛤️🚘
